BRIT also anglicise
V-T If you anglicize something, you change it so that it resembles or becomes part of the English language or English culture. 使英语化; 使英国化
He had anglicized his surname.
他已使他的姓氏英语化了。
anglicized ADJ
...anglicized French words such as cafe.
...英语化了的法语词,比如咖啡馆。
